The current passing through a galvanometer is 30 mA, resistance of the galvanometer is 50 Ω and a shunt is 1 Ω is connected to the galvanometer. What is the maximum current that can be measured by this ammeter?(a) 1.53 A(b) 15.3 A(c) 0.153 A(d) 153 AThe question was asked in semester exam.My query is from Moving Coil Galvanometer in chapter Moving Charges and Magnetism of Physics – Class 12 |
|
Answer» CORRECT answer is (a) 1.53 A The best I can explain: GIVEN: Ig = 30 mA = 0.03 A; S = 1 Ω; G = 50 Ω Required EQUATION ➔ Maximum current (I) = \( [ \frac {(S + G)}{S} ] \) × Ig I = \( [ \frac {(50 + 1)}{1} ] \) × 0.03 I = 51 × 0.03 I = 1.53 A |
